## Break-Glass Access — Gallerytone Audio Guide

If the Gallerytone app backend for the Merriden Museum goes fully unresponsive and standard admin login is unavailable, on-call may use the break-glass account. This bypasses tour-content review gates, so use it only for outages affecting visitors on-site. File an incident in Hallboard within one hour of use. The break-glass account unlocks with the recovery passphrase shown below.

vault phrase of bagaf-kajeg = jorath-feniel-briir-siliel-ralix

## DiffHarbor — Data Stores

For reviewers touching persistence code, three stores matter:

- **Blob cache**: chunked file segments, content-addressed, evicted after 14 days.
- **Diff index**: precomputed hunk maps for files over 50 MB.
- **Metadata DB**: Postgres; review state, file manifests, chunk pointers.

Migrations live in `db/migrations`; run them before review if schema changed. The metadata DB is reached via the connection string below.

primary connection of yagep-kahip = redis://giliel_svc:zYiKsLL2PLpfPL@db-348f.xolmarsys.corp:5432/fenwyn

Off-site run checklist — item 7: trophy engraving, Silverlark Awards Night.
- Collect twelve engraved trophies from Hartquill Engravers, Dunmoor unit.
- Verify spelling on each nameplate against the master list before accepting.
- Pack in the foam-lined crates only; no loose wrapping.
- Crates travel upright; flag the driver if any plinth rattles.
- Receiving site signs the condition sheet on arrival.
Delivery is time-locked to the venue setup window, so the hand-over instruction below applies.

courier memo of yawep-yafog: the pramir ulaix courier leaves the ulavan aldix frair zorok oliiel joreth rusdor fenvan ledger at gate 1305 under passcode 514738

## Tuning

The Hueledger contrast audit crawls every themed component in the Farrowkit design system and flags pairs below threshold. Runtime scales with theme count times component variants, so on large palettes the audit can dominate CI. You can trade thoroughness for speed: sampling fewer intermediate shades rarely misses real failures, but dropping below three samples per gradient has produced false passes. Adjust concurrency to match runner cores. The defaults below reflect what ships with Farrowkit.

constants for tageg-kagag:
QUOTAS = {
    "kelax": 495,
    "istath": 366,
    "tammir": 108,
    "novdor": 730,
    "casax": 816,
    "quenael": 874,
    "pelius": 403,
}